Concrete Forest by Strangers Parfumerie is an unusual unisex eau de toilette for those who love contrasts and unconventional perfume stories.
The name brings together forest and concrete, and this combination best conveys the character of the composition: vibrant greenery, cool air and a mineral urban texture.
The fragrance belongs to the floral and green families, but its character can hardly be called conventionally delicate or traditionally fresh.
Here, natural motifs seem to break through modern architecture: damp vegetation meets dry woody nuances, while transparent florals take on a cool, almost graphic form.
At first, Concrete Forest comes across as a sharp green burst with a citrus spark, cool mint and the sensation of clean mountain air.
Notes of cucumber, ginkgo, galbanum and ivy create the effect of freshly cut greenery, combining juiciness with a touch of bitterness.
Thanks to the mineral concrete accord, the composition smells less like a walk through an ordinary garden and more like a futuristic forest landscape.
As it develops, the green nuances soften into the floral transparency of camellia, magnolia, iris and lily of the valley.
At the same time, the fragrance retains its cool temperament: the flowers do not become a sweet bouquet, but rather illuminate the central idea of Concrete Forest.
Cedar, moss and woody bamboo emerge in the base, creating a clean, slightly dry and noticeable trail.
The fragrance is said to have very strong sillage, so Concrete Forest can become an expressive part of an outfit even when applied moderately.
No precise recommendation for the number of sprays on skin or clothing is provided. However, when discovering the composition, it is sensible to start with a small amount and observe how it develops throughout the day.
The fragrance will appeal to those who prefer distinctive green compositions with mineral and woody facets.
Concrete Forest was created by Prin Lomros, a perfumer whose work with unusual materials helps the composition sound bold and contemporary.
In this release, natural notes do not merely imitate a forest; they enter into dialogue with urban space, creating a distinctive image at the intersection of botany, architecture and art.
This approach reflects the niche concept of Strangers Parfumerie: the Thai brand explores unexpected stories and transforms everyday impressions into fully developed olfactory narratives.
Concrete Forest will interest both women and men, especially those looking to move beyond standard citrus, aquatic or classic woody fragrances.
This eau de toilette is made for lovers of green freshness without excessive sweetness or obvious ornamentation.
It works well in the city, while travelling, on a walk and whenever you want to emphasize an independent character.
In terms of mood, Concrete Forest is especially appealing in warm weather, but its cool mineral base can also sound intriguing during the transitional seasons.

Concrete Forest brings together angelica, bamboo, concrete, cucumber, galbanum, ginkgo, green tea and mountain air.
A citrus accent of mandarin and orange enhances the feeling of coolness, while mint adds a crisp freshness to the composition.
The floral heart is shaped by camellia, iris, lily of the valley and magnolia, all rendered with transparency so they do not overwhelm the green framework.
Ivy, moss and cedar deepen the composition, giving it a woody, earthy foundation.
The result is a multilayered green fragrance with floral purity, a mineral nuance and the atmosphere of a modern forest among concrete.
